Black Formation: Volcanic glass formed fromApple Valley Jasper is collected from the same location and the popular Apple Valley Agate (Sahara Desert of Morocco), but it is actually a fossil stromatolite! Stromatolites are a form of ocean colonizing bacterial called cyanobacteria that get trapped in sediment layers!
